					IBM (NYSE: IBM) and the Australian Bureau of Statistics (ABS) today announced  that more than 2.6 million households across Australia submitting Census forms via the web-based eCensus solution. This represents a significant jump from the 2006 Census, when 778,000 (9.1 per cent) of Australian households completed their forms online.
